什么是用户接口系统
用户接口系统是DSS内用于和DSS用户直接打交道的软件系统,一些资以“UIS”标识它,有些资料又称它为“人机对话系统(Dialg System)”,还有资料称它为“接口(Interface)”。
UIS起着在用户、数据库和模型库之间传送命令和数据的作用,DSS中的模型库、数据库以及用户的意图正是通过UIS来沟通的。对于UIS,人们应当不会太陌生,因为TPS或MIS中同样也有人机接口的问题,只是DSS中的人机接口有些特殊的要求,由于DSS中建模和使用模型的困难,一般用户望而生畏,此时就特别需要一个用户界面友好、方便的UIS。 1.
UIS的主要功能1、通过交互式的人机对话,DSS了解用户要解决何种问题,用户了解将以何种模型解决其问题,这里所说的用户应主要理解为那些对模型有一定了解但并非专业建模人员的管理者。
2、用户能够了解模型在运行中输入了那些数据,中间及最终结果如何,这些数据是从何种数据库中提取的,数据的可靠性如何等。
3、具有“What--if”等灵敏度分析功能,以便用户更好地了解模型,找出模型中的关键变量。
4、方便用户修改模型。模型经演算后,用户可能会发现模型的某些不足,从而需要重新考虑修改决策变量、约束条件或某些参数,UIS应该给用户一个宽松、灵活的环境,方便用户修改模型。
5、按用户要求,输出有关的图形及表格。1
结构用户接口系统打交道的主要是:1、数据库管理系统DBMS;2、模型库管理系统MBMS;3、用户。
而UIS内部主要的成分是:
1、输入响应模块。将用户随机输入的数据变换为DSS所能接收的数据;
2、输出模块。将DSS产生的数据变换为用户所能接收的数据;
3、人机对话管理模块。用于在对话期间对输入、输出的数据、命令进行管理;
4、外围设备管理程序。用于和计算机外围设备如屏幕、打印机绘图仪等交流信息。